What’s good about the Nikon COOLPIX L120
Best price
$394
- Smaller body size 42 in³ vs 47 in³
- Higher resolution rear screen 921k dots vs 230k dots
- Better light sensitivity by 1 f-stop 6,400 ISO vs 3,200 ISO

What’s good about the Samsung WB100
Best price

- Significantly cheaper street price $140 vs $394
- Higher sensor resolution 16.2 MP vs 14.1 MP
- Has longer exposure available 8 seconds vs 4 seconds
- Newer camera June 2012 vs February 2011
- Longer optical zoom 26.0× vs 21.0×
- Has 3D capture capabilities L120 does not have 3D

What the Nikon L120 and Samsung WB100 have in common
- Weigh about the same 15.3 oz vs 14.22 oz
- Similar image sensor size 28 in²
- Same viewscreen size 3.0″
- Same quality video capture 720p 30fps
- HDMI port
- panorama mode
